What Is Esports Betting?
Esports betting refers to wagering on professional video game competitions. These tournaments feature popular titles such as Dota 2, League of Legends, and Counter-Strike: Global Offensive. Millions of fans watch these matches, making esports one of the fastest-growing sectors in entertainment — and now, a major part of online casino betting.
How Esports Betting Works
Just like traditional sports, players can bet on various outcomes — the winner of a match, total rounds, or specific in-game events. Odds are determined by the teams’ performance histories and statistics. Many casinos now integrate live streams, allowing users to watch and bet simultaneously.
Why Esports Betting Is So Popular
The younger generation, raised on digital games, finds esports more relatable than traditional sports. The fast pace, strategy, and team-based dynamics create an engaging betting experience. Additionally, esports events run year-round, providing consistent opportunities for wagering.
Betting Markets and Strategies
Successful esports bettors study team compositions, patch updates, and individual player statistics. Because video games evolve quickly, understanding recent balance changes can give bettors a competitive edge. Live or “in-play” betting adds another layer of excitement by letting users place wagers mid-match.
